Abstract

This paper investigates the use of e-portfolios on the Google Sites platform to support students in developing their English reading skills. E-portfolios, implemented as individual pages on Google Sites, provide students with a flexible tool to organize and reflect on their reading activities. The results indicate that integrating e-portfolios into reading activities allows students to personalize their learning materials, develop autonomous learning skills, and thereby enhance their reading comprehension in a digital learning environment. The paper also addresses challenges in implementation, such as limitations in equipment and lack of technological skills, and thus proposes possible solutions.
